Small Group Tour from London: Cotswolds Village, Stonehenge, and Bath Tour

Explore Cotswolds, Bath, and Stonehenge on a luxury small group tour from London. Discover historic sites with expert guides. Limited to 16 guests.

Duration: 11 hours, 30 minutes
Cancellation: 24 hours
Highlights
  • Stonehenge - Explore one of the most renowned and celebrated prehistoric landmarks in the world. Stonehenge, which is 5000 years old.
  • Bath - Spend 2 to 2.5 hours here with an optional walking tour led by a tour guide for those interested. In addition to our time on the ground, we offer a panoramic driving tour through some of Bath’s most…

Great day of sightseeing and learning - We had a memorable experience with The English Bus on this long day trip. Our tour guide, Tony, took great care of our group throughout the journey. Not only was he a skilled guide and storyteller, he also did a solid job of communicating logistical details such as meeting times and locations during the outings. That leads me into something I really appreciated about this tour - I like that at each destination (especially Stonehenge and Bath) I had freedom and options for how to spend my time. Among the 14 or so people on the small group tour, I'm sure we each had different experiences based on what we chose to do. I've done a handful of small group tours over the years. This one was among the very best due to the well considered itinerary (no, it's not too much for one day), the comfortable modern van/bus, and Tony's capable guiding. The nice weather was just a bonus for us.
